Exterior Painting in Arvada, CO
Exterior pain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int to the exterior surfaces of residential properties, including siding, trim, doors, and other visible features. These projects typically aim to enhance curb appeal, protect the home from weather elements, and extend the lifespan of exterior materials. Homeowners often request exterior painting when preparing for a sale, updating the look of their property, or addressing existing paint deterioration such as peeling, cracking, or fading.
Before requesting exterior painting,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including surface preparation, weather considerations, and the types of paint suitable for their home’s materials. It’s also common to inquire about color options, surface cleaning methods, and whether any repairs are necessary prior to painting. Clear communication about these aspects helps 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, visually appealing finish.

Common Exterior Painting Jobs
Exterior wall painting - enhances curb appeal and protects against weather elements.
Siding painting - refreshes the look of vinyl, wood, or fiber cement siding.
Fence painting - improves durability and adds a polished finish to wooden or metal fences.
Deck and porch painting - revitalizes outdoor living spaces and shields wood surfaces from damage.
Garage door painting - updates the appearance and extends the lifespan of garage doors.
Trim and accent painting - adds detail and contrast to architectural features around the property.
Exterior Painting Questions
What types of exterior surfaces can be painted? Exterior painting services typically cover siding, stucco, brick, wood, and trim to enhance the appearance and protection of a property.
Is surface preparation important before painting? Yes, proper cleaning, scraping, and priming ensure better paint adhesion and a longer-lasting finish.
What are common reasons to consider exterior painting? Homeowners often choose exterior painting to update the look, repair weathered surfaces, or improve curb appeal.
How can I choose the right paint for my exterior? Selecting the right paint depends on the material, climate conditions, and desired durability for the property.
